News Reg Rogers, Henry Stram, Alton Fitzgerald White Set for Music-Theatre Jam Celebration Music-Theatre Jam, a one-night-only event, will feature material from past Music-Theatre Group performances in honor of the organization's 40th anniversary.

The showcase, featuring scenes from Julie Taymor and Elliot Goldenthal's Juan Darien, among others, will play at One Arm Red in DUMBO April 9.

Performers include Tshidi Manye (The Lion King), Kenita Miller, Milton Craig Nealy (The Full Monty, Caroline or Change), Reg Rogers (Free Man of Color), Henry Stram (Spring Awakening, Titanic), Alton Fitzgerald White (The Lion King), Laura Innes (The Event), Rinde Eckert (Pulitzer Prize Finalist, Obie Award winner), Brenda Currin, John DiPinto, Gary Fagin, Gabriel Kahane, Yusef Komunyakaa and Teresa McCarthy.

The evening will begin at 6 PM with cocktails with the performance to follow.
